Wake Forest University Liberal Arts General Studies Master’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 36% of liberal arts general studies master’s degrees went to men and 64% went to women.

Wake Forest University gender breakdown of Liberal Arts General Studies Master's degree grads

The majority of liberal arts general studies master’s degree graduates at Wake Forest University were White. About 36% of graduates fell into this category.

Liberal Arts and Sciences/Liberal Studies at Wake Forest University

Wake Forest University awarded 11 degrees in liberal arts and sciences/liberal studies in the latest year of data — 64% to women and 36%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(36%).
